在现代软件开发中,Unix类系统(如Linux或macOS)提供了强大的命令行工具和灵活的环境配置能力。搭建一个高效的Unix开发环境是迈向专业开发的第一步。
安装基础工具是关键。大多数Unix系统自带了基本的开发工具链,但为了更高效的工作,建议安装GCC编译器、Make构建工具以及Git版本控制软件。可以通过包管理器(如apt、brew或yum)轻松完成安装。
配置环境变量可以提升工作效率。通过编辑~/.bashrc或~/.zshrc文件,将常用工具的路径添加到PATH变量中,这样可以在任何位置直接调用这些工具。
使用文本编辑器或IDE也是开发过程中不可或缺的部分。Vim、Emacs等轻量级编辑器适合快速编写代码,而Visual Studio Code或JetBrains系列则提供了更丰富的功能支持。

AI绘图结果,仅供参考
•熟悉常用的命令行操作能极大提高生产力。例如,使用ls查看目录内容,grep搜索文本,find查找文件,以及curl或wget下载资源。
从零开始搭建Unix开发环境并不复杂,只要掌握基础工具和配置方法,就能为后续的开发工作打下坚实的基础。